Requirements
  • Experience leading teams in a fast-paced production or operational setting.
  • Solid understanding of digital print equipment (e.g. HP presses, Kerns, finishing equipment).
  • Great organizational and communication skills, with a hands-on mindset.
  • Confident in managing staffing levels and rotas, especially during peak periods.
  • Committed to maintaining high safety, quality, and cleanliness standards.
  • Comfortable working cross-functionally with ops, maintenance, and supply chain teams.
  • Enthusiastic about driving continuous improvement and team development.
Responsibilities
  • Lead, coach, and support print room operators, ensuring high performance and team engagement.
  • Liaise with Shift Managers to prioritise tasks and allocate resources across shifts.
  • Manage stock, consumables, and print room materials, ensuring timely reordering.
  • Escalate and follow up on any technical issues with the Maintenance Technician – Print.
  • Keep the print room safe, clean, and organised at all times.
  • Oversee equipment checks (SOS and EOS) and assist in coordinating preventative maintenance.
  • Maintain detailed records of incidents, handovers, and shift activity.
  • Support training, onboarding, and continuous improvement across the team.

Moonpig Group runs an online marketplace that specializes in personalized greetings cards, gifts, and flowers for customers in the UK, US, Australia, and the Netherlands through the Moonpig and Greetz brands. It uses technology to let customers customize products and manage ordering, printing, and delivery, handling more than 50 million orders each year. The platform differentiates itself by offering customizable products at scale across multiple markets with reliable fulfillment and a strong focus on customer experience. The company's goal is to provide a seamless, personalized gifting experience that makes celebrating occasions easy and enjoyable, while growing revenue and expanding its geographical footprint.

Greggs Launches First Ever Christmas Cards With An Edible Twist

Greggs launches first ever Christmas cards with an edible twist. * High street bakery launches first-ever Christmas cards with an edible twist * Heat-activated ink reveals a code for a free sausage roll or vegan alternative * Partnered with Moonpig to make Secret Santa gifts easier for stressed shoppers Greggs is turning Christmas cards into snacks this year and sausage roll lovers are already drooling at the thought. The high street bakery has launched its first range of festive cards, each hiding a code for a free sausage roll, including the vegan one, all for £3.95 under the name "The Ultimate Secret Santa Surprise". Will Barker reported in Money News Today that the clever cards use heat-activated ink: warm up the design and a unique code appears, ready to be redeemed in-store for a pastry fix. No tat, no panic-buying, just a guaranteed crowd-pleaser. Customers can also personalise the designs, including uploading a photo of a loved one, making it feel more like a proper gift than a last-minute dash through the seasonal aisle. Greggs has teamed up with online card giant Moonpig after a poll revealed just how stressful Secret Santa can be. Four in ten people admitted feeling anxious about the swap, while more than two-thirds confessed they end up panic-buying something forgettable. A third of respondents said they'd be happy or delighted to receive a Greggs sausage roll as a gift, and one in ten even claimed it would make their Christmas Day if they unwrapped one. Hannah Squirrell, customer director at Greggs, said: "Latest Deals Limited is all about bringing a smile to people's faces, and what better way to do that at Christmas than with a card that comes with a tasty treat? "Partnering with Moonpig means fans can now send festive wishes with a Greggs twist, whether it's a laugh for your Secret Santa or a surprise for someone who's tricky to shop for, our exclusive collection with Moonpig offers a fun way to say 'Merry Christmas'... and yes, there's a free sausage roll in it too." Moonpig UK marketing director Rachael Halliday added: "By teaming up with Greggs, we're giving people a fun, thoughtful and easy way to show they care - because sometimes the smallest gestures, like a personalised card with a little treat inside, make the biggest impact." The launch comes hot on the heels of Greggs officially kicking off its festive season, with the beloved Festive Bake back on counters alongside other Christmas specials, fuel for shoppers racing between queues, parties and Secret Santas.
